I am an expert level John Barnes trained Myofascial Release Practitioner and Physical Therapist.  I’ve had a lifelong passion for the body and the beautiful ways that it moves, expresses itself, and heals itself. 

 

Myofascial Release is the most caring, effective, and long-lasting healing modality I’ve used in my nineteen years as a Physical Therapist and I’ve dedicated myself to this work completely since 2018.  I truly believe in this work and know it to be a treatment affecting the physical, emotional, energetic, and spiritual realms. It’s a profound gift and I feel blessed when a patient entrusts me with their care through this potent and intuitive bodywork. I find the process to be most effective when a patient is willing and ready to step into vulnerability, trust and mutual commitment to the healing process.

 

My career as a Physical Therapist has led me along a path of working in a variety of settings including my current private Myofascial Release practice, orthopedics, neurological rehab, trauma, vestibular rehab, geriatrics, home health, personal training, holistic lifestyle coaching, and Myofascial Release. I hold a Master’s in Physical Therapy, a Bachelor’s in Athletic Training, a Certified Sports & Conditioning Specialist certification, and a certification as a Professional Life Coach with an emphasis in communication and relationship coaching.
